Output a1e21f366f8cf281f5d9c54e7a7834925d4e00c0d80e526c375fde4a104ff67d:0

value
6217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20442fb66075a7e01bc0483822e0c65fa15de74d OP_EQUAL
address
34ddEMXuJy3d4hjrbXD4cfDcVDidp8oB5q
transaction
a1e21f366f8cf281f5d9c54e7a7834925d4e00c0d80e526c375fde4a104ff67d